Redis缓存不一致问题如何解决 第一章 Redis之缓存可能遇到的问题 文章目录Redis缓存不一致问题如何解决前言一、Redis是什么?二、使用Redis带来的缓存不一致问题1.搭建高可用的分布式缓存总结 前言 在单机、并发量...
redis 数据库双写一致性
Redis缓存预热是指在服务器启动或应用程序启动之前,将一些数据先存储到Redis中,以提高Redis的性能和数据一致性。这可以减少服务器在启动或应用程序启动时的数据传输量和延迟,从而提高应用程序的性能和可靠性。
缓存失效的极端情况分类和解决办法
REDIS缓存数据库在JAVA中的使用ppt
Redis的缓存过期策略通常有三种: 一、定时过期 每个设置过期时间的key都需要创建一个定时器,到过期时间就会立即清除。 优点:该策略可以立即清除过期的数据,对内存很友好; 缺点:若过期key很多,删除这些key会会...
增加springboot启动成功后方法执行。
基于Redis缓存商城分类以及商品信息,实现商城数据高速精确访问,源码,jar包
redis缓存分享,包含redis和redis测试的项目test
1. 什么是缓存穿透以及危害? 缓存穿透:指请求的key在缓存中没有对应的数据,此时去查找数据库,结果发现数据库也没有数据或者数据库有数据但没有存进缓存,最终导致缓存中一直找不到数据,查询都是直接访问数据库...
一、缓存命中率 命中:可以直接通过缓存获取到需要的数据,而不是从数据库中获取 不命中:无法直接通过缓存获取到想要的数据,需要再次...如何查看Redis缓存命中率 redis-cli -h xx -p xx info stats可以看到 keyspa
和Memcache一样,Redis数据都是缓存在计算机内存中,不同的是,Memcache只能将数据缓存到内存中,无法自动定期写入硬盘,这就表示,一断电或重启,内存清空,数据丢失。所以Memcache的应用场景适用于缓存无需持久化...
缓存预热 1、定义 缓存预热就是系统上线后,提前将相关的缓存数据直接加载到缓存系统。避免在用户请求的时候,先查询数据库,然后再将数据缓存的问题!用户直接查询事先被预热的缓存数据! 2、解决方案 1)直接写个...
SpringBoot集成Redis缓存并实现初始化用户数据到Redis缓存1、springboot集成Redis缓存1.引入依赖2.添加配置3.测试是否成功2、实现初始化用户数据到Redis缓存1.listener监听类2.实体表中需要序列化3.findById示例4....
标签: redis
Redis缓存老师笔记
缓存中间件——Memcache和Redis的区别? Memacache:代码层次类似Hash,简单易用。 1.支持简单数据类型 2.不支持数据持久化存储 3.不支持主从 4.不支持分片,分割数据进行存储 Redis:主流缓存中间件 1
基本缓存知识介绍,Redis相关知识介绍,Redis的分片、主从、集群技术分享,缓存使用技巧总结。
流缓存redis 在 redis 中缓存流 安装 npm install stream-cache-redis 用法 var getSlowStream = require ( './my-slow-stream' ) var cachedStream = require ( 'stream-cache-redis' ) ( { cache : ...
本篇文章主要介绍了Java自定义注解实现Redis自动缓存的方法,具有一定的参考价值,感兴趣的小伙伴们可以参考一下。
redis缓存机制 一、缓存更新 缓存更新的策略有很多,这里介绍两种比较主要的情况: 第一种情况,先更新数据库再同步更新缓存或者先更新缓存再同步更新数据库,其实都属于write through,同步更新的好处在于可以很好...
本篇详细介绍了Redis缓存中的双写一致性的问题,包括一些解决方案